Trophic Strategy
Occurs in seaward reefs. Usually over rocky or coral substrates, at boulder-strewn slopes at the base of high-island cliffs where it may occur in large schools. Large adults usually on upper parts of deep slopes, but seen to about 35 m depth . Roving herbivore, that feeds on detritus, turf algae and macroalgae . Was observed to feed in an oblique head-down position, scraping the surface of the turf-covered substratum. Each bite produced a pair of narrow paralle scarpes marked by dislodged algae; scarring of the substartum occurred only occasionally. The bite rate was approximately 15-20 bites per minute, with most bites being grouped in short feeding bouts. Once ingested, all algae were finely triturated by the action of the pharyngeal apparatus. Only a few filaments remained intact . Also Ref. 58652.

Distribution
Indo-Pacific: East Africa south to Durban, South Africa and east to the Tuamoto Islands, north to the Ryukyu and Hawaiian islands, south to Shark Bay, Western Australia and the southern Great Barrier Reef. Eastern Pacific: Gulf of California to the Galapagos Islands .
